
MAE Research Day 2019 was held on Friday, September 13, 2019.
Congratulations to all of the speakers who made presentations and to Alex Novoselov, the winner of the MAE Research Day prize and runner up, Estella Yu.
Adam Fisher: Liquid Metal Systems for Fusion Reactors
Sam Otto: Leveraging Dynamics for Near-Optimal, Ultra-Sparse Sensor Placement
Estella Yu :Speed-dependent Filtration Using the Motion of a Translating Bubble
Matthew Heinrich: Growth Dynamics of Large, Freely Expanding Epithelial Monolayers
Alex Novoselov: Turbulent Nonpremixed Cool Flames: Experiments, Simulations, and Models
